remove prefix letter 'k' from constant

This commit is contained in:
ashilkn 2022-09-23 13:54:21 +05:30
parent 5e4db4b2a0
commit de0988ff51

View file

@ -13,7 +13,7 @@ class FeatureFlagService {
static final FeatureFlagService instance =
FeatureFlagService._privateConstructor();
static const kBooleanFeatureFlagsKey = "feature_flags_key";
static const booleanFeatureFlagsKey = "feature_flags_key";
final _logger = Logger("FeatureFlagService");
FeatureFlags? _featureFlags;
@ -33,7 +33,7 @@ class FeatureFlagService {
FeatureFlags _getFeatureFlags() {
_featureFlags ??=
FeatureFlags.fromJson(_prefs.getString(kBooleanFeatureFlagsKey)!);
FeatureFlags.fromJson(_prefs.getString(booleanFeatureFlagsKey)!);
// if nothing is cached, use defaults as temporary fallback
if (_featureFlags == null) {
return FeatureFlags.defaultFlags;
@ -74,7 +74,7 @@ class FeatureFlagService {
.get("https://static.ente.io/feature_flags.json");
final flagsResponse = FeatureFlags.fromMap(response.data);
if (flagsResponse != null) {
_prefs.setString(kBooleanFeatureFlagsKey, flagsResponse.toJson());
_prefs.setString(booleanFeatureFlagsKey, flagsResponse.toJson());
_featureFlags = flagsResponse;
}
} catch (e) {